Business processes evolve dynamically with changing business demands. Because of these fast changes, traditional process improvement techniques have to be adapted and extended since they often require a high degree of manual work. To reduce this degree of manual work, the automated planning of process models is proposed. In this context, we present a novel approach for an automated construction of the control flow structure simple merge (XOR join). This ac-counts for a necessary step towards an automated planning of entire process models. Here we build upon a planning domain, which gives us a general and formal basis to apply our ap-proach independently from a specific process modeling language. To analyze the feasibility of our method, we mathematically evaluate the approach in terms of key properties like termina-tion and completeness. Moreover, we implement the approach in a process planning software and apply it to several real-world processes.
